    Diabetic foot is the most serious and expensive acute and chronic disease of diabetes, and the more serious ones may cause high amputation and death. Diabetic foot is caused by the synergy of diabetic neuropathy and diabetic vascular disease. It is manifested by ulceration of the foot, sensation and damage to its deep structures.

    The occurrence of diabetic foot is actually best understood that, on the one hand, diabetes causes neuropathy, and the distal nervous system of the foot is very susceptible; On the other hand, diabetic vascular disease, the arteries in the legs are narrowed, and the blood vessels in the feet certainly cannot get enough blood in the night. Many patients with hyperglycemia will have numbness in their feet, which is one of the more significant manifestations of hyperglycemia.

    This is mainly due to your own central nervous system pathology, and you should not ignore this feeling, when their nervous system is affected, you will most likely lose some intuition in your steps. If you have high blood sugar, your feet and toes will be habitually cold for no reason, even in very warm areas, your toes will not have a normal temperature. In fact, the root cause of this is that when the blood sugar is too high, the body's blood circulation system slows down, and the feet are far away from the core of the blood supply, and the blood flow is not smooth.

    When the blood sugar content in the diabetic patient's body is too high, the blood circulation system will also produce certain problems, the patient may have intermittent claudication, and the patient will feel pain when walking for a long time, and it can be recovered after resting. However, if it is left unchecked, it is likely to be harmful to walking, and even if you don't walk, you will feel pain. Limb pain (macrovascular disease):

    The ischemic nature of the body caused by arteriosclerosis spots in the legs is gradually manifested as intermittent claudication, which is the pain in the limbs when walking, and the symptoms will gradually lessen when you have to slow down and rest. If the condition progresses more severely, it will evolve into a resting state and cerebral ischemia pain will occur.

    The skin, especially the toes, becomes purple, black, and even ulcerated (macrovascular capillary disease). In view of the ischemia at the end of the body, the tone of the toes becomes darker, some skin temperatures are low, and they feel cold, often accompanied by pain, and obviously avascular necrosis, dry gangrene, and the risk of paraplegia. **Paresthesias such as itching, ant walking, numbness and other paresthesias (neuropathy).

    Diabetes mellitus can cause peripheral neuropathy, and patients develop paresthesias. The main manifestations are ant crawling, numbness, loss of environmental temperature awareness, some diabetic patients in winter when soaking their feet because they feel that the temperature of the water can not come out and be burned.
